Gabriel Vick revealed as Mrs. Doubtfire as new comedy musical preps for London stage debut

Gabriel Vick as Mrs. Doubtfire in the London stage show

Get ready to laugh and sing along with the iconic character of Mrs. Doubtfire once more as she hits the stage in London’s Shaftesbury Theatre this May. The highly anticipated musical production promises to be a hilarious and heartwarming story of a father’s unwavering love for his children.

Stepping into the iconic role is Gabriel Vick, best known for his work in Avenue Q, and from these first look photos he’s picture perfect for the role. Laura Tebbutt from School of Rock plays opposite in the role of Miranda Hillard. Carla Dixon-Hernandez from Matilda the Musical is Lydia Hillard, and Cameron Blakely from Newsies is Frank Hillard.

Other cast members include Marcus Collins from Kinky Boots, Samuel Edwards from Anything Goes, and Ian Talbot OBE, who is not only part of the cast but also the director of The Mousetrap.

Based on the beloved film starring the late Robin Williams, Mrs. Doubtfire tells the story of out-of-work actor Daniel Hillard, who will do anything to stay in his kids’ lives after a messy divorce. In a desperate attempt to see them, he creates the persona of Scottish nanny Euphegenia Doubtfire, and as this new character takes on a life of her own, Daniel learns some valuable lessons about fatherhood.

Mrs. Doubtfire was created by a team from both sides of the Atlantic. Wayne Kirkpatrick and Karey Kirkpatrick are responsible for the original music and lyrics, while Karey Kirkpatrick and John O’Farrell (known for their work on Something Rotten!) wrote the book. The direction is by 4-time Tony winner Jerry Zaks, with choreography by Lorin Latarro and music supervision, arrangements, and orchestrations by Ethan Popp.

The scenic design is by David Korins (Hamilton), costume design by Catherine Zuber (Moulin Rouge! The Musical), lighting design by Philip S. Rosenberg (Pretty Woman The Musical), sound design by Brian Ronan (Beautiful: The Carole King Musical), and hair design by David Brian Brown (Frozen). The casting is by Stuart Burt, with Verity Naughton as the Children’s Casting Director.

Mrs. Doubtfire is set to begin performances on May 12, 2023.
